Adjusting the clutch: Throwout Bearing and Clutch Fingers!

What kind of clutch mechanism, cable or mechanical? For cable it is common to have the t.o. bearing just touching the diphragm springs, but not tension on the cable. With a mechanical clutch linkagage you should have about .030" air gap between the TO bearing and clutch fingers...this amounts to 1/4"-1/2" of pedal travel before you are moving the clutch.
